WHAT IF I DONT CHANGE THE MAIN JET WHEN I GO FROM A 3000 AND LOWER ALTITUDE TO ABOUT A 4500 ALTITUDE? I HAVE A DYNO JET KIT AND IM PUTTING THE MAIN NEEDLE JET FROM 3000FT AND LOWER. WILL THERE BE COSTLY CONSEQUENCES PLEASE HELP. THANKS
#3
We run our z400 from sea level to about 5500' feet with no problems[img]i/expressions/face-icon-small-smile.gif[/img] If it does effect your motor, just be prepared for a little lag time in the response you get from the engine.
